WebAug 12, 2024 · A "Merge" node merges two control nodes, i.e. two branches of control flow. You can think of it as the "opposite" of a Branch, or the equivalent of a Phi for control nodes. Control nodes are the mechanism that Turbofan's sea-of-nodes design uses to make sure nodes aren't reordered across certain control flow boundaries.

A merge may be a … symbiotic swarm preconWebNov 29, 2024 · The use of the term "back merge" is usually somewhat arbitrary. It just means to do a merge, like any other, but in a direction that is "backwards" compared to the normal flow of the branching conventions.
